Title
Update consistency in software-defined networking based multicast networks
Abstract
When applying updates on distributed network elements with SDN, intra-update states may violate desired network properties, such as drop- and loop-freeness. Current stateless approaches cannot guarantee the constancy of arbitrary network invariants (correctness) in general, yet update procedures guaranteeing certain invariants do exist. In this paper, we investigate on update consistency for the case of multicast routing and show that there is no correct update procedure w.r.t. both drop- and duplicate-freeness. We show that certain updates of multicast routes inherently raise a concurrency issue, which necessarily results in the occurrence of either drops or duplicates. Furthermore, we present a generic update procedure for multicast routing updates that identifies concurrency-relevant update steps. This procedure allows for the selection of an update strategy, such that either drops or duplicates are avoided. These effects can severely degrade network performance or quality of experience. To investigate the implications of drops and duplicates, we evaluate their frequencies and impact for wide-area network scenarios both, analytically and empirically, through direct measurement in the data plane under update.
Year
DOI
Venue
2015
10.1109/NFV-SDN.2015.7387424
2015 IEEE Conference on Network Function Virtualization and Software Defined Network (NFV-SDN)
Keywords
Field
DocType
update consistency,software-defined networking-based multicast networks,distributed network elements,SDN,intra-update states,drop-freeness,loop-freeness,duplicate-freeness,generic update procedure,multicast routing updates,concurrency-relevant update step,quality-of-experience,wide-area network scenario
Forwarding plane,Concurrency,Computer science,Correctness,Computer network,Quality of experience,Multicast,Network element,Software-defined networking,Network performance,Distributed computing
Conference
Citations 
PageRank 
References 
1
0.35
11
Authors
3
Name
Order
Citations
PageRank
thomas kohler110.35
Frank Dürr250043.83
Kurt Rothermel32806450.84